Treatments for Excessive Sweating

Hyperhidrosis (Excessive Sweating)

We have two methods for treating excessive sweating; Morpheus8 and Botox!

Morpheus8 uses microneedling and radiofrequency technology to heat to desensitize the sweat glands preventing them from being overactive.

Botox® has been FDA approved to treat excessive underarm sweating.  When injected into targeted areas of the skin, such as the underarms, it can help prevent this excessive sweating when topical ointments for overactive sweating fail to work. Botox® for severe sweating works by preventing chemical signals from certain nerves in the body that activate sweat glands. This causes the stimulation of overactive sweating to stop in the treated areas.
